¿Cómo redondear un rango de números al número par más cercano en Excel?
¿Qué es el redondeo a par en Excel? El redondeo a par, también conocido como redondeo bancario, funciona igual que el redondeo habitual, salvo cuando la cifra a redondear termina en 5. En ese caso, si el dígito anterior al 5 es impar, se redondea hacia arriba; si es par, se redondea hacia abajo.
Por ejemplo, 23,345 redondeado a par en la centésima sería 23,34 y 12,335 redondeado a par en la centésima sería 12,34.
En este artículo te explicaré cómo aplicar el redondeo bancario en Excel.
Redondear números a par con una función definida por el usuario
Redondear números a par con código VBA
Redondear números a par con Kutools para Excel
Redondear números a par con una función definida por el usuario
Puede utilizar la siguiente función definida para redondear números al par más cercano en Excel. Siga estos pasos:
1. Seleccione los números que quiera redondear al número par más cercano.
2. A continuación, mantenga pulsadas las teclas ALT + F11 y se abrirá la ventana de Microsoft Visual Basic para Aplicaciones.
3. Haga clic en Insertar > Módulo y pegue la siguiente macro en la ventana del módulo.
Function BankersRound(num, precision)
BankersRound = Round(num, precision)
End Function
4. Guarde el código e introduzca la fórmula =bankersround(A1;2) en la celda adyacente vacía. Vea la captura de pantalla:

5. Pulse después la tecla Intro. Seleccione la celda B1 y arrastre el controlador de relleno hasta el rango en el que desee aplicar esta fórmula. Vea la captura de pantalla:

Redondear números a par con código VBA
Si prefiere no utilizar la función definida, el siguiente código VBA también le será de ayuda. Siga estos pasos:
1. Seleccione el rango que desee redondear al número par más cercano.
2. A continuación, mantenga pulsadas las teclas ALT + F11, y se abrirá la ventana de Microsoft Visual Basic para Aplicaciones.
3. Haga clic en Insertar > Módulo y pegue el siguiente código en la ventana del Módulo.
Sub RoundToEven()
'Update 20131107
Dim rng As Range
Dim WorkRng As Range
Dim intNumberOfDecimal As Integer
On Error Resume Next
xTitleId = "KutoolsforExcel"
Set WorkRng = Application.Selection
Set WorkRng = Application.InputBox("Range", xTitleId, WorkRng.Address, Type:=8)
intNumberOfDecimal = Application.InputBox("NumberOfDecimal", xTitleId, Type:=1)
Set WorkRng = WorkRng.SpecialCells(xlCellTypeConstants, xlNumbers)
For Each rng In WorkRng
rng.Value = Round(rng.Value, intNumberOfDecimal)
Next
End Sub 4. Pulse después la tecla F5 para ejecutar este código; en el cuadro emergente, introduzca el número de decimales al que desea redondear. Vea la captura de pantalla:

5. A continuación, haga clic en Aceptar; todos los números seleccionados se redondearán a par. Vea las capturas de pantalla:
![]() | ![]() |
Redondear números a par con Kutools para Excel
Ni la función definida por el usuario ni el código VBA le parecerán tan complejos: le presento una forma sencilla de resolverlo. Con Redondeo sin usar fórmulas de Kutools para Excel, podrá redondear rápidamente un rango de números al número par más cercano.
Kutools para Excel incluye más de 300 herramientas prácticas para Excel. ¡Pruébelo gratis sin limitaciones durante 30 días! Obtenerlo ahora.
Tras instalar Kutools para Excel, proceda del siguiente modo:
1. Resalte el rango que desee redondear a par.
2. Haga clic en Kutools > Redondear.
3. En el cuadro de diálogo Redondeo sin usar fórmulas, introduzca el número de decimales que necesite y, a continuación, seleccione Redondear a par en Opción; podrá previsualizar el resultado en el Panel de vista previa. Vea la captura de pantalla:

4. A continuación, haga clic en Aceptar o en Aplicar; todos los números se redondearán a par con 2 decimales.
Haga clic en «Redondear a par» para obtener más información sobre esta función.
Artículo relacionado:
Redondear / redondear hacia arriba / redondear hacia abajo un rango de números de celdas en Excel
Las mejores herramientas de productividad para Office
Potencie sus habilidades en Excel con Kutools para Excel y experimente una eficiencia como nunca antes.Kutools para Excel ofrece más de 300 funciones avanzadas para aumentar su productividad y Ahorrar tiempo.Haga clic aquí para obtener la función que más necesita...
Office Tab aporta una interfaz con pestañas a Office y hace que su trabajo sea mucho más fácil
- Active la edición y lectura con pestañas en Word, Excel, PowerPoint, Publisher, Access, Visio y Project.
- Abra y cree varios documentos en nuevas pestañas dentro de la misma ventana, en lugar de hacerlo en ventanas separadas.
- ¡Aumente su productividad en un 50 % y elimine cientos de clics del ratón cada día!
Todos los complementos de Kutools en un solo instalador.
Kutools for Office es la suite que incluye complementos para Excel, Word, Outlook y PowerPoint, además de Office Tab Pro, ideal para equipos que trabajan en distintas aplicaciones de Office.
- Suite integral— complementos para Excel, Word, Outlook y PowerPoint + Office Tab Pro
- Un instalador, una licencia— configuración en minutos (compatible con MSI)
- Rendimiento mejorado en conjunto— productividad optimizada en todas las aplicaciones de Office
- Prueba gratuita de 30 días con todas las funciones— sin registro ni tarjeta de crédito
- La mejor relación calidad-precio— ahorre frente a la compra individual de complementos

